Karl Barth: Seminar

Ronald F. Thiemann

Description

An intensive reading and research course on the work of Karl Barth. Attention will be given to the theological and political development throughout his work, including his involvement in the German church struggle. Close reading of the \Church Dogmatics/ during the second half of the seminar. Prerequisite: at least one course in modern theology.
